Summary
A ruined shelter or lodge built into the base of a south-facing tinwork scarp on the north side of the River Plym identified in 2022 during survey work. The buildings is an irregular shape roughly built from coursed moorstone, but utilising the slope of the scarp as the back wall. The interior measures approximately 4.6m by 3m and the walls are approximately 0.8m high. The date is uncertain but this may be a relatively modern feature.
